Secondary School Teacher, Except Special and Career/Technical Education Salary in Washington-Arlington-Alexandria, District of Columbia

The annual salary statistics of secondary school teachers, except special and career/technical education in Washington-Arlington-Alexandria, District of Columbia is shown in Table 1. The wage data of secondary school teachers, except special and career/technical education in Washington-Arlington-Alexandria is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1. Annual Salary of Secondary School Teachers, Except Special and Career/Technical Education in Washington-Arlington-Alexandria, District of Columbia

Percentile BracketAverage Annual Salary
10th Percentile Wage
$48,560
25th Percentile Wage
$61,630
50th Percentile Wage
$78,680
75th Percentile Wage
$103,380
90th Percentile Wage
$136,250

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for secondary school teachers, except special and career/technical education in Washington-Arlington-Alexandria, District of Columbia in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$136,250.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$78,680.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$48,560.
